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Valley Village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Valley Village with 1 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Valley Village is at Harmony Gates listed at $1,205.

How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Valley Village Apartment?

The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Valley Village is $2,449.

What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Valley Village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Valley Village is a 1,900 square feet unit starting from $1,500 at 10720 Hortense St.

What is the average size for Valley Village 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Valley Village is currently 550 sq ft.
